New
Energy Ltd was set up in the island of Malta in 1998, initially,
a by-product of more than 8 years experience in the production
of OEM battery packs for Telital.
The original scope of the company was to manufacture non-original
mobile phone batteries for the aftermarket sector's demands
of replacement batteries. Being a very quality conscious company
right from the start of its operation, the quality and consistency
demands was high. At the same time, the manufacturing costs
were constantly under review in order to maintain a competitive
edge with rival European and Asiatic competitors.

A good market in Italy and France was secured. As sales orders
continued to increase, the Malta operation grew steadily both
in production volumes and employee head count. In the first
2 years of existence, the company exceeded all its expectations,
and is now baldly looking forward to venture into new enterprises.
With good engineering resources and a stable, versatile workforce,
the company set out to broaden its scope and product ranges
during last year. The process of ISO certification was started.
Investments, both in personnel and equipment were carefully
made. These efforts are already showing results.
The first OEM project was launched in mid 2000. A battery
pack for a power assisted bicycle supplied by Merida, one
of the world's market leaders. This NiMH battery pack is now
in production at New Energy Ltd. During this year, more OEM
projects, both for local and foreign customers were initialised
and confirmed.
Another significant milestone is the partnership agreement
signed with a reputable American manufacturer of high quality,
litium polymer cells. By means of this partnership agreement,
New Energy Ltd. will be able to assemble battery packs for
any application specifically requesting the American producer's
product.
